Permatang Pauh flourished by 26 August by-election

I will be very thankful to Presiden PKR Datuk Seri Dr Wan Azizah Wan Ismail and Dato Seri Anwar Ibrahim if I am one of the Permatang Pauh area residents.
Why?
Recent news in Malaysiakini showed that BN had throw in more than 650 million in Permatang Pauh by-election.
This include:
1) Education ministry donate a total of 1 million for 5 chinese schools in Permatang Pauh. Money released in 4 days.
2) Prime Minister Abdullah promised to release half million ringgit to build a new public toilet in Seberang Jaya after receive complaint and feedback about lack of public toilet in the area during his visit to local chinese religious societies.
3) Education ministry release another 20,000 ringgit to a chinese school for expanding its assembly hall.
4) Deputy Prime Minister, Najib also annouce another half a million donation to build a covered basketball court for a chinese school.
5) On 20-August, Najib also donate 1.82 million to local muslim mosque and prayer room in Seberang Jaya.
6) On the same day Malaysia badminton player Lee Chong Wei receive his award by the country, Najib also annouce another 800 thousand ringgit donation to build a 3 storey multi-purpose sport complex in Seberang Jaya.
7) On 22 August, Najib again hand out another 1.4 million donation to a local mosques and prayer rooms.
8) Najib also agree to renew long frozen steel recycle business license back to indian community to promote them to run their own business.
9) Najib also annouce that federal government had approve a special funding of 30 hundred thousond ringgit to build a center for handicap, single mothers in Seberang Jaya.
Apart from all these donation, residents in Permatang Pauh also enjoy free food, entertainment, lucky draw, hampers, special allowance, transport allowance and all sort of other allowance during the past 10 days…
